Vai skaitīšanas funkcija uzskaita nulles vērtības?
Vai skaitīšanas funkcija uzskaita nulles vērtības?

Video: Vai skaitīšanas funkcija uzskaita nulles vērtības?

Video: Vai skaitīšanas funkcija uzskaita nulles vērtības?
Video: COUNT, DISTINCT, and NULLs in SQL Server 2024, Decembris
Anonim

Piemērs - Funkcija COUNT ietver tikai NAV NULL Vērtības

Ne visi to apzinās, bet gan COUNT funkcija būs tikai skaitīt ieraksti, kuros izteiksme NAV NULL iekšā SKAITĪT (izteiksme). Kad izteiksme ir a NULL vērtība , tas nav iekļauts SKAITĪT aprēķinus.

Jautāja arī, kā postgresql saskaitīt nulles vērtības?

2 atbildes. Izmantot skaitīt (*): atlasiet skaitīt (*) no vilciena, kur ir "kolonna". NULL ; skaitīt () ar jebkuru citu argumentu skaitās ne- NULL vērtības , tāpēc tādu nav, ja ir "kolonna". NULL.

Turklāt, kas atgriež rindu skaitu ar vērtībām, kas nav nulles? Funkcijas SQLite COUNT() ilustrācija Šajā piemērā COUNT(c) atgriež numuru no nav - nulles vērtības . Tas uzskaita dublikātu rindas kā atsevišķi rindas.

Ir arī jāzina, vai grupas funkcijas ignorē nulles vērtības?

Atbilde: A. Izņemot COUNT funkciju , visi grupas funkcijas ignorē NULL vērtības.

Ko skaits (*) dara SQL?

SKAITS(*) atgriež rindu skaitu norādītajā tabulā un saglabā rindu dublikātus. Tas skaitās katru rindu atsevišķi. Tas ietver rindas, kurās ir nulles vērtības.

Ieteicams: